An electron-emission mechanism for cold cathodes is described based on
the enhancement of electric fields at metal-diamond-vacuum triple jun
ctions. Unlike conventional mechanisms, in which electrons tunnel from
a metal or semiconductor directly into vacuum, the electrons here tun
nel from a metal into diamond surface states, where they are accelerat
ed to energies sufficient to be ejected into vacuum. Diamond cathodes
designed to optimize this mechanism exhibit some of the lowest operati
onal voltages achieved so far.
